What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R  1926.451(a)(6):Scaffolds were not designed by a qualified person:  On or about August 8, 2023, a JLG G12-55a telehandler (S/N 0160041386) was used to support a scaffold platform that was not designed by a qualified person.

29 CFR  1926.451(c)(2)(iv):Front-end loaders and similar pieces of equipment were used to support scaffold platforms without being specifically designed by the manufacturer for such use:  On or about August 8, 2023, a JLG G12-55a telehandler (S/N 0160041386) was used to support a scaffold platform without being specifically designed by the manufacturer for such use.

29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13): Each employee(s) eng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above lower levels were not protected by guardrail systems, safety net system, or personal fall arrest system, nor were employee(s) provided with an alternative fall protection measure under another provision of paragraph 1926.501 (b):        On or about August 8, 2023, employee(s) working from roof areas more than 33 feet above the ground were not protected from falls, thereby exposing the employees to fall hazards.
